  • the Avenue of the Baobabs In the afternoon, visit to the Avenue of the Baobabs is scheduled to enjoy the breathtaking sunset.
    Sunset is expected at 5:49 PM.

    At dusk the sky changes to deep reds and purples, and the giant baobabs cast dramatic shadows. The ever-changing contrast between the sky and the land is spectacular and is one of Madagascar's iconic scenic views. The moment of sunset is especially impressive and is a popular time for photography. [Japanese Guide]

  • the sunrise at the Avenue of the Baobabs Early morning departure to witness the sunrise at the Avenue of the Baobabs.

    At dawn the sky is dyed a pale orange, and the baobab trees lined up as silhouettes quietly emerge. There are relatively few tourists, and you can spend a relaxing time in the clear air. Soft morning light illuminates the land, allowing you to enjoy a magical landscape. [Japanese Guide]

  • Sightseeing of the town of Antananarivo It is the capital of Madagascar and the political, economic, and cultural center. The city is characterized by its hilly terrain, and from the high ground you can get a panoramic view of the urban area. Attractions such as the historic royal palace ruins Rova and lively markets are scattered around, and it is a city where you can experience Madagascar's history and everyday culture. [Japanese Guide]
